廣州番禺區(qū)硬件設(shè)計培訓(xùn)學(xué)校排名,隨著*政策的調(diào)整,針對廣州嵌入式開發(fā)培訓(xùn),下面小編將具體的情況在這里給大家一一普及一下,嵌入式開發(fā)學(xué)什么,嵌入式的硬件設(shè)計,嵌入式的硬件層。
1.嵌入式開發(fā)學(xué)什么
學(xué)習(xí)嵌入式開發(fā)需要學(xué)習(xí)的內(nèi)容還是很多的,首先是編程語言,編程語言要學(xué)習(xí)C語言,還有就是操作系統(tǒng)和Linux系統(tǒng)基礎(chǔ)等內(nèi)容。嵌入式呢看起來是需要學(xué)習(xí)很多內(nèi)容的,但是學(xué)習(xí)進(jìn)去了后就能學(xué)到很多有用的知識。學(xué)完后就可以就業(yè)了。
2.嵌入式的硬件設(shè)計
底層是硬件層:完成端口掃描,20ms延遲去抖,將端口數(shù)據(jù)映射到寄存器,作為上層驅(qū)動層的接口。 中間層是驅(qū)動層:驅(qū)動層只對KEY_DAT寄存器的值進(jìn)行操作無論底層硬件如何接線,只需要關(guān)心 寄存器的值。 這樣做的間接效果是“屏蔽了底層硬件的差異”,所以驅(qū)動層寫的程序可以通用。
3.嵌入式的硬件層
驅(qū)動層和應(yīng)用層的要求不是很嚴(yán)格但是硬件層要分開, 實(shí)際上,對于一些簡單的項(xiàng)目,沒有必要將兩層分開。 根據(jù)實(shí)際應(yīng)用靈活應(yīng)對即可。 其實(shí)用這種方式寫程序是很方便的。 根據(jù)板卡的不同,可以適當(dāng)修改硬件層的ReadPort功能。 驅(qū)動層和應(yīng)用層的很多代碼無需修改即可直接使用,可大大提高開發(fā)效率。
小編給大家的分析嵌入式開發(fā)學(xué)什么,嵌入式的硬件設(shè)計,嵌入式的硬件層,是否還是解除了一些內(nèi)心疑惑和苦惱呢,其實(shí)各行各 業(yè)很多東西都是相通的,就看你怎么去選擇和看待。廣州番禺區(qū)硬件設(shè)計培訓(xùn)學(xué)校排名
尊重原創(chuàng)文章,轉(zhuǎn)載請注明出處與鏈接:http://g8efho.cn/news_show_4643086/,違者必究!